Elevated Timber Cabins

These Hillside Cabins Provide Individual Lodgings for the Awasi Hotel

'Felipe Assadi Architects' recently designed a series of cozy timber cabins that provide lodging for guests staying at the Awasi Hotel. Many people come to the Patagonia region to get a glimpse of wild creatures interacting in their natural habitat. These compact cabins provide the perfect space to view wild llamas, pumas and rheas from up close.

The Awasi Hotel is located just outside the Torres del Paine National Park in Chile's Patagonia region. The hotel boasts 12 timber cabins, each of which is perched on the edge of a steep hillside. The cabins are designed to blend into the natural landscape and not disrupt the animal's habitat. Despite the simplistic exterior, each cabin is equipped with a bedroom, bathroom, lounge and sitting area. The interior is completely covered in wood, which makes each cabin feel warm and cozy.
